Karin Kraai joined Newmark Knight Frank’s landlord advisory division as a senior managing director in 2011. An accomplished landlord representative, Ms. Kraai focuses on the strategic growth of the office agency practice in Chicago, with a primary focus on the CBD. Ms. Kraai brings 25 years of experience representing real estate owners, users and investors, with expertise across the entire spectrum of asset management, leasing and marketing services, such as repositioning, value-add and long-term hold strategies. Widely recognized for her success with managing and increasing portfolio values, Ms. Kraai is credited for growing portfolios valued in excess of $2.1 billion.
Ms. Kraai’s prior experience includes a strong track record with Jones Lang LaSalle, Lincoln Property Company and Vornado Realty Trust. As regional leasing director at Jones Lang LaSalle, Ms. Kraai managed the Chicago leasing team, exceeded production goals for the region and was key in winning several additional new assignments. At Vornado Realty Trust, as a player/coach for the Merchandise Mart Properties Division, Ms. Kraai managed the leasing teams in Chicago, Washington D.C., and
Boston. The strategy she initiated increased occupancy from 84% to 98% and increased portfolio value 163%.
As an entrepreneur, Ms. Kraai created Forest Partners Real Estate LLC, with a focus on strategic team partnering to manage and execute the marketing, leasing and disposition process for portfolios that needed to be repositioned and leased for a hold or disposition strategy. Clients included advisory groups working on receivership and sublease portfolios, niche building owners with unique office leasing challenges, understaffed corporate real estate departments and banks with REO
office assets.
Select clients include BDT Capital, GE Capital, Bank of America, Ernst & Young, Citigroup, BFGImmoinvest, Overseas Partners Capital Corporation, Equitable Real Estate, Lend Lease, Harris Bank, Unitrin, Dorchester Corporation, Lincoln Property Company, WPP, and Publicis.
Ms. Kraai has served on the board for the Goldie Wolfe Miller Women Leaders in Real Estate Initiative for the past nine years and was elected president of the board for 2015-2017. The Goldie Initiative is a 501c3 that provides scholarship funds to selected candidates who exhibit ability and leadership potential. The contenders are then mentored and monitored as they work through their program toward receiving a Masters in Business Administration/Real Estate or a Masters of Science in Real Estate degree.
Ms. Kraai was on the board for the City of Hope annual REACH fundraiser for 10 years. She is a member of CREW and COLBA, and a past member of the Greater Chicago Food Depository steering committee. Ms. Kraai is a past nominee for Crain’s Leasing Broker of the Year.
Ms. Kraai holds an MBA in finance and economics from Loyola University, Chicago, and an undergraduate degree in marketing and economics from Eastern Illinois University. Ms. Kraai holds a managing broker’s license in the State of Illinois.
